Dances of Universal Peace

DATES AND TIMES

  • Sunday, Jul 16, 2017 4 - 6 p.m.

LOCATION: The Meditation Place - 324 Main St


The Dances of Universal Peace are simple, meditative, joyous, multi-cultural circle dances that use sacred phrases, chants, music and movements from the many spiritual traditions of the earth to touch the spiritual essence within ourselves and recognize it in others.

Restorative CiderYoga w/Kevin Flynn


DATES AND TIMES

  • Sunday, Jul 16, 2017 10-11 am

LOCATION: St. Vrain Cidery - 350 Terry St

visit website


Part Flow, Part Restorative. This practice is an hour long and moves through physical postures slowly and mindfully. Yogis spend about 5 minutes practicing breath and intention setting, 15 minutes warming up, 20 minutes balancing and flowing, and 20 minutes restoring, physically and mental. BRING: Water bottle, yoga mat*, yoga blanket (optional), and an open mind. *Loaner mats available via Kevin, email to reserve. COST: $8/person (includes a 4oz pour of cider after the class) CONTACT: Kevin Flynn at [email protected] WHO: This class offers a practice for any age, body, and level of yoga experience. Never practiced yoga? This is a great place to start. Looking to go deeper in your practice?
